When athletes walk out of rehab, they often lack the speed, strength, and agility they once had. They can shoot free throws but can’t go coast-to-coast. Can hit a bag but can’t block a lineman. There’s a gap between the therapy and competitive performance. Mettler’s Bridge program wants to change that.
Bridge is designed to help athletes transition from physical therapy to the intensity of competitive play. You’ll begin with a consultation by a Mettler Athletic Physical Therapist, then work one-on-one with a Performance Coach. The 10 session program is progressive and individualized. Learn movement mechanics, eliminate muscle imbalances, and recover strength and speed. When you’re done, your body will be ready for the rigors of all-out athleticism.
